this is common problem on Mk1's and Mk2's, it is a worn syncronmesh that causes this. I had the same problem on my Mk2 but I would not be to woried as it does not mean your box is about to go, mine started about 60,000 miles ago and I am sure other people with Mk1/Mk2 will tell you they have gearboxes that have been doing this for many miles. You just learn not to hammer from 1st to 2nd.
or stick on a weighted shift rod from a mk3 rod box - 11.70 from VAG the extra interia created dampens down the scrunch
